Chubb has promoted Andy Macfarlane to the newly-created position of regional manager, Scotland and the North.
Macfarlane, who was previously regional manager, Scotland, now has an extended role which includes Chubb’s branches in Manchester, Leeds and Newcastle, in addition to his current responsibility for Scotland. He will work with the existing management structure to continue to support and further develop relationships with Chubb’s brokers and clients.
The promotion is effective immediately and Macfarlane will continue to report to Sara Mitchell, head of Corporate Division, UK and Ireland, Chubb.
Sara Mitchell, head of Corporate Division, UK and Ireland, Chubb, said creating one region for the North and Scotland “brings together the collective strength of a powerful team which will reinforce to our brokers and clients why working with Chubb is such a compelling proposition.”
